Our structure was miles, miles, miles better! this was Manchester United boss Ole Gunnar Solskjaer expression after his team defeated Arsenal 3-1 at Emirates Stadium on Friday night.
In an after match press conference, Ole said he was happy on the level of improvement the players are coming up with.
‘It was a massive step forward for us performance-wise. As a team, the structure in the team was miles, miles, miles better compared to Tottenham a couple of weeks ago, where we hung in there and David (de Gea) saved us,’ he said.
‘Today, Sergio (Romero) had a fantastic save at the start of the first half, but our structure was miles, miles, miles better. ‘We have been working on that, we need to dig in and defend properly against good teams.
‘I am not here to get excited, I am here to keep on improving the team, improving the players and just look to the next game (against Burnley). ‘It is a league game, a massive league game for us at home again. Tomorrow we will enjoy sitting back in the chair and enjoy watching the FA Cup.’
